MinIO just introduced AIStor Tables, embedding the Iceberg Catalog REST API directly into AIStor. No external transactional database needed.

Fivetran's acquisition strategy has been impressive to watch:

HVR ($700M) - Enterprise change data capture
Teleport Data - High-speed database replication
Census - Reverse ETL & data activation
Tobiko Data - Advanced transformation
